Loading...
298 tools
Adds diacritical marks to text using combining characters, transforming plain text into accented letters with ease. Ideal for users needing to add accents or other diacritical marks to words quickly and efficiently. Perfect for writers, students, and anyone who frequently works with text requiring special character markings.
Removes diacritical marks from text, simplifying characters by stripping away accent symbols. Helps users prepare text for processing or analysis by normalizing Unicode characters to their base form, making data uniform across different systems. Ideal for developers working with global text, linguists cleaning up datasets, and anyone needing consistent character encoding in their workflows.
Replaces letters with visually similar homoglyphs to obfuscate text. Enter your text, select replacement options, generate obfuscated version. Ideal for hiding secrets in plain sight, protecting confidential information, or creating unique identifiers.
Restores homoglyphs to standard letters. Converts encoded characters back to readable text by replacing similar-looking but distinct symbols with their proper counterparts. Useful for developers, security experts, and anyone dealing with potentially malicious or obfuscated Unicode text. Helps ensure accurate interpretation of data by eliminating the risk of misreading characters that may appear identical but have different meanings.
Detects whether text contains lookalike homoglyph characters to prevent spoofing attacks. By analyzing Unicode characters, it flags potentially misleading or malicious text that may appear legitimate but is actually disguised. Businesses, governments, and individuals concerned with cybersecurity would use this tool to verify the authenticity of digital communications, protecting against phishing attempts and other forms of identity theft.
Cyclically Shift Unicode shifts each character in a given string by a specified number of positions within the Unicode code point range, wrapping around if necessary. Users input their text, select the shift amount, and click "Shift" to see the transformed output. It's useful for experimenting with Unicode characters, creating obfuscated text, or testing encoding limits. Developers, linguists, and anyone working with Unicode characters may find Cyclically Shift Unicode helpful for debugging encoding issues, exploring character properties, or generating unique identifiers by manipulating their underlying code points.
Converts Unicode characters to JavaScript-style escape sequences by taking an input string containing Unicode characters and outputting the corresponding escape sequences. This tool helps users encode strings for use in web development, ensuring compatibility with JavaScript environments. Developers, programmers, and web content creators who need to include special characters or non-ASCII text in their code can benefit from this tool. It simplifies the process of encoding these characters, reducing potential errors in data transmission and display.
Converts Unicode characters to HTML numeric entities. This tool allows users to input Unicode text, and it will output the corresponding HTML numeric entity codes. Useful for developers, web designers, and anyone working with Unicode characters in HTML content. Useful for developers needing to embed special characters or symbols in their websites without using images or fonts that support those specific characters. Web designers can use it to ensure compatibility across different browsers and devices. Students and educators can benefit from it when creating multilingual educational materials online.
Converts Unicode characters into percent-encoded format for URL transmission. Takes any input string containing Unicode characters and encodes them, replacing each character with its corresponding hexadecimal value prefixed by a percentage sign (%). Useful for web developers, programmers, and anyone needing to ensure that special characters in URLs are properly transmitted over the internet without causing errors or being misinterpreted by servers.
Converts Unicode text into Base64 format online, enabling easy data encoding for compatibility across different systems or applications that require Base64 encoded input. Ideal for developers, web designers, and anyone needing to ensure text can be safely transmitted over networks without corruption.
Converts Unicode text into a Data URI by encoding it. This tool takes any Unicode string input, then encodes it to create a valid Data URL that can be used in web applications for embedding data directly within HTML or CSS files. Ideal for developers looking to embed small amounts of text or images directly into their code without needing to reference external files. Developers and designers who need to integrate inline content on websites will find this tool useful, particularly for creating responsive designs where assets are loaded directly from the page source. It's a handy solution for those seeking a quick way to convert Unicode data into a format that can be easily embedded within web pages.
Converts Unicode characters to raw byte values, allowing users to see the underlying binary representation of any given character in the Unicode standard. Ideal for developers, programmers, and anyone working with international text or data encoding. Helps users understand how Unicode characters are stored and transmitted by converting them into their corresponding byte values, facilitating debugging, compatibility testing, and other technical tasks involving Unicode text processing.
Converts Unicode characters to binary representation by entering text in the provided input field. The tool then processes the input, converting each character into its corresponding binary form, which is displayed as output. This functionality allows users to understand the underlying binary code of Unicode characters used in digital communication and data storage. Useful for developers, programmers, and anyone dealing with Unicode encoding for web development, software engineering, or digital content creation. It aids in debugging and verifying correct Unicode character representation across different platforms and systems.
Converts Unicode characters to octal representation, providing a quick way to understand the numerical values behind text in different encodings. Ideal for developers, software engineers, and anyone working with internationalization or needing to debug character encoding issues.
Converts Unicode characters to their decimal (base-10) representation, allowing users to easily translate between these two formats for various applications, including programming, data encoding, and character set conversions. Developers, programmers, web developers, and anyone working with internationalized text or specific Unicode code points will find this tool invaluable. It helps in debugging, validating data formats, and ensuring compatibility across different systems that may handle Unicode differently.
Converts Unicode characters to hex (base-16) representation, allowing users to easily translate text into its hexadecimal form for various applications such as web development or data encoding tasks. Helps users in programming, web design, and IT who need to work with Unicode characters and require a quick way to convert them to their hexadecimal equivalents.
Converts Unicode symbols to raw ASCII bytes, this online tool facilitates the transformation of complex characters into their corresponding ASCII representations. Users input Unicode strings, and the tool processes them, outputting the equivalent ASCII values. Ideal for developers, programmers, and anyone working with character encoding, it simplifies compatibility issues and data transmission challenges. Developers, particularly those working on multi-language applications or integrating systems from different parts of the world, find this tool invaluable. It ensures accurate data exchange by converting Unicode characters into a universally understood format. Students and educators also benefit from its use in understanding character encoding and decoding processes.
Converts ASCII bytes to Unicode symbols with a simple interface. Paste ASCII input into the provided field, and the tool instantly converts each byte to its corresponding Unicode symbol, displaying the results in real-time. Users interested in character encoding, web development, or digital humanities may find this useful for debugging encoding issues, creating internationalized text, or understanding how characters are represented at a lower level.
Converts Unicode text into a format suitable for string literals in programming languages, making it easier to handle special characters within code. Simply input the Unicode text, select the desired programming language, and the tool outputs the formatted string literal ready for use in your project. Developers and programmers who need to include special characters in their code, such as emojis or non-Latin alphabets, will find this tool invaluable. It saves time manually escaping and formatting these characters by generating the correct syntax automatically, ensuring that the text is correctly interpreted by the programming language.
Converts emojis into downloadable images of various resolutions, allowing users to easily share or resize their favorite symbols as needed. By entering an emoji in the tool's interface, users can generate a customizable image that can be saved and used in digital projects. This tool would be particularly useful for designers, bloggers, and social media managers who frequently use emojis in their content but require them in higher resolution for better quality graphics or larger display purposes.
Generates Zalgo Unicode by applying chaotic combining-character glyphs to text, creating an effect of distorted, pixelated letters. Users input their text, click generate, and receive the zalgo-ified version for fun or artistic expression. Suitable for anyone looking to add a playful twist to messages, create unique visual effects, or experiment with typography. Ideal for gamers, artists, and anyone interested in exploring Unicode's possibilities.
Strips Zalgo combining characters to make text readable again. Converts garbled, distorted text back to its original form by removing the extraneous characters that cause visual distortion. Users with broken links, social media posts, or any text containing Zalgo characters would find this tool helpful in recovering the intended message and maintaining readability.
Splits text into smaller chunks by chosen delimiter or length. Users input their text and select a split method (e.g., commas, spaces, custom characters) or specify a chunk size in characters or lines. The tool then outputs the divided text. Ideal for content editors needing to organize large texts, developers preparing data for processing, and anyone looking to simplify text for readability or analysis.
Joins multiple lines of text into one using a custom delimiter, making it easy to consolidate data or prepare text for further processing. Simply input your text and select a delimiter like a comma or semicolon, then click join. Users who need to combine scattered pieces of text, such as merging logs, preparing CSV files, or consolidating content from multiple sources, will find this tool helpful.